How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Ellis Historic?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Ellis Historic Studio Apartments | $948 | $849 | $1,270 |
Ellis Historic 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,141 | $479 | $1,705 |
| Ellis Historic 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,465 | $700 | $2,350 |
| Ellis Historic 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,323 | $995 | $2,220 |
| Ellis Historic 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,800 | $1,800 | $1,800 |
